井水位长周期事件记录及其机理的讨论

摘    要:选择了几口具有代表性的观测井.并对这些井孔在强震前记录到长周期波现象的特征进行了分析。从理论上对地震前的长周期事件给出了较为合理的解释.认为地震前一些敏感井水位长周期事件可能反映了断层蠕动、静地震与慢地震、断裂的预扩展和地震成核等。井一含水层系统像一个长周期地震仪,它为记录到有价值的前兆低频波提供了最佳的频率响应范围。

Well-water level records of long period events and its mechanism

Abstract:The characteristics of long period waves, recorded at several representative wells before large earthquakes, are analyzed. The reasonable explanation on these long period events occurred before earthquakes is given in theory. It is thought that the long period water level events, occurred at some sensitive wells before earthquakes, may be related to the process such as fault creeping, silent and slow earthquake, fault pre extending and seismic source nucleation. The system consisting of well and water layers behaves like a long period seismograph. The system responds very well to the valuable precursor low frequency waves.
